Procesos Claves De Desarrollo
1. Procesos para negociar con el cliente y satisfacerlo
Vender el proyecto
Identificar factores de satisfacción del cliente y/o prioridades para el proyecto
Formalizar administrativamente el inicio del proyecto
Negociar cambios al alcance y requerimientos (en términos de duración y facturación)
Formalizaradministrativamente la terminación del proyecto
Recibir peticiones de corrección de defectos amparados por la garantía en el servicio
Efectuar el cobro correspondiente por los servicios prestados y los productos recibidos
Obtener retroalimentación del cliente con respecto al servicio y productos recibidos periódicamente
2. Actividades para administrar el equipo de desarrollo
Planear las actividades delequipo de desarrollo dentro del proyecto
Obtener los recursos necesarios para la ejecución del proyecto
Organizar funciones y responsabilidades de las personas dentro del equipo de desarrollo
Revisar cumplimiento de planes y compromisos
Supervisar / auditar la ejecución de las actividades dentro del desarrollo y revisar las características necesarias de los productos que se generan dentro delproyecto
Administrar / controlar los cambios en los productos generados dentro del proceso de desarrollo
Evaluar y retroalimentar el desempeño de los recursos durante la ejecución del proyecto
Anticipar posibles problemas durante la ejecución del proyecto y prevenirlos
3. Actividades para generar productos entregables
Describir la forma de operar del negocio (sin sistema)
Definir elalcance funcional del software
Describir / Modelar el sistema como lo percibe el usuario (diseño funcional)
Definir los requerimientos para implantar el sistema en la organización
Definir las características y restricciones técnicas de la solución
Obtener / Desarrollar subsistemas de soporte
Describir / Modelar el sistema como lo construirá el programador (diseño técnico)
Codificar y probarunitariamente cada componente de software
Probar el desempeño del software
Probar comportamiento externo (funcional) del software
Elaborar manuales para: instalar el sistema, operar servicios interactivos, operar procesos batch y asignar valores a parámetros configurables del sistema
Liberar / Entregar los componentes de software de la solución
Efectuar la conversión de datos / carga inicial dedatos del sistema
Reparar los defectos que presente el software después de su liberación
Modelo de Proceso de Desarrollo de Software de SOFTTEK
ADR – Administrar los requerimientos del cliente
Objetivo
Establecer un entendimiento común entre el cliente y los miembros del proyecto de software acerca de los requerimientos que deben ser solucionados por el proyecto desoftware. Este acuerdo con el cliente es la base para planear y administrar el proyecto de software.
Metas
• Lograr que en todos los proyectos exista un acuerdo inicial con el cliente sobre el alcance del proyecto para que sirva de base de negociaciones y firma de acuerdos, que adicionalmente sirva como base del control económico del proyecto.
•
Productos de entrada
• SOL-1Solicitud de propuesta
• SOL-2 Solicitud de cambio a requerimiento(s)
Productos de salida
• ADR-1 Propuesta
• ADR-2 Carta de aprobación de alcance firmada
• ADR-3 Cambio a requerimiento(s) aprobado
• ADR-4 Acuerdo de mecánica de solicitud de cambio
Actividades
El promotor debe recibir y evaluar los requerimientos del usuario y con base en ellos elaborar una propuesta que defina elproblema de la organización y el objetivo del desarrollo, al mismo tiempo que describa el sistema a construir y las condiciones de negociación establecidas para el proyecto de desarrollo. Como apoyo a este proceso se recomienda tomar el TISAA (Técnicas de ingeniería de software aplicadas al análisis).
Una vez aprobado el proyecto, se debe firmar una carta de aprobación del alcance inicial que...
Regístrate para leer el documento completo.